Latest Patents

One of her latest patents is focused on the regulation of nucleic acid molecule expression. This invention provides a nucleic acid molecule dimer that includes a first nucleic acid molecule with complementarity to a target nucleic acid molecule and a second nucleic acid molecule that complements the first. The first nucleic acid molecule is linear, while the second is cyclic, allowing them to partially form a double strand. Another significant patent involves an adhesive preparation containing bisoprolol. This preparation includes a backing and a pressure-sensitive adhesive layer, which is formed on one side of the backing. The adhesive layer contains a polymer created through copolymerization of monomers, including a hydroxyl group-containing monomer and an alkyl (meth)acrylate monomer, along with bisoprolol.
